Research Medical Surgical RN Job Trends in Fountain Valley

If you’re a Medical Surgical RN curious about Travel job trends in Fountain Valley, CA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 4 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,139 and a range from $1,989 to $2,260 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 92708.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Medical Surgical RNs in Fountain Valley’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Medical Surgical RNs Expect in Fountain Valley, CA?

As a Medical Surgical RN in Fountain Valley, California, you’ll find a diverse range of opportunities across various healthcare facilities, including community hospitals, outpatient clinics, and rehabilitation centers. In these settings, you can expect to provide comprehensive patient care, monitoring vital signs, administering medications, and coll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to develop and implement individual care plans for patients recovering from surgery, injury, or acute illnesses. Fountain Valley’s proximity to high-quality medical facilities, such as Fountain Valley Regional Hospital, ensures a dynamic work environment where you’ll engage in patient education, support discharge planning, and assist with post-operative care. Registered Nurse – Med Surg jobs at the facility in Goodyear, AZ offer you the chance to work in a thriving Level 1 Trauma Center serving the West Valley. The hospital is known for advanced care in orthopedics, stroke, vascular, and women’s health, with a collaborative and supportive environment. To qualify, you need an active RN license and Basic Life Support (BLS) certification. At least two years of recent medical-surgical nursing experience is required, along with strong communication and patient assessment skills. Experience with electronic medical record (EMR) systems is important.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) certification and a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) are recommended. Frequently Asked Questions about Travel Medical Surgical RN Jobs near Fountain Valley, CA

What is the average pay for a Medical Surgical RN Travel job in Fountain Valley, California?

The average pay for a Medical Surgical Registered Nurse Travel job in Fountain Valley, California is approximately $2,139 per week. This data was last updated on June 5, 2026.

What is the highest pay typically available for a Medical Surgical Registered Nurse Travel job in Fountain Valley, California?

The highest pay typically available for a Medical Surgical Registered Nurse Travel job in Fountain Valley, California is $2,260 per week. This is based on data last updated on June 5, 2026.

What types of experience are required or preferred for an MS Travel job in Fountain Valley?

Candidates for a Medical Surgical Registered Nurse travel job in Fountain Valley, California typically need to have at least one year of clinical experience in a medical-surgical setting, along with an active California RN license. Familiarity with electronic health records and strong communication skills are also preferred to ensure effective patient care and collaboration with the healthcare team.
